Crockpot Breakfast Casserole
1 32-ounce bag of frozen southern style hashbrown potatoes (aka frozen shredded potatoes)
1 lb. of bacon cut into pieces, fried & drained
1/2 c. diced onions
1 green pepper diced
3/4 lb. cheddar cheese diced
1 dozen eggs
1 c. milk
1/2 tsp. dry mustard
salt & pepper to taste
Directions:
Layer the frozen potatoes, bacon, onions, green pepper and cheese in the crock pot in two
or three layers. Finish up with cheese. Beat the eggs, milk, mustard, salt & pepper
together. Pour over whole mixture, Cook on low for ten to twelve hours.
PERSONAL NOTES:
* I use the store brand potatoes which are much cheaper, and the taste is just as yummy
* I personally do not add the onion & green pepper as my kiddos would not eat it if I did.
I would assume adding onions & peppers gives it sort of western omlet taste, but I don't
know.
* I have substituted ham, sausage, grilled turkey and grilled chicken (at different times) for
the bacon. My DH, DS12 & DS6 like it with any kind of meat. Any meat works just fine. I
personally do not eat red meat, so I make a smaller version for myself in my "lil dipper"
crockpot which contains no meat at all. Still yummy.
* Dry mustard - I have no idea what purpose this ingredient serves. If you don't have it on
hand I really don't think it would make that much difference.
